Ordinals
beta
Address bc1qw7pfqkyqrl3xw3pdlkkzuagwkvs0uqjp9tpy6s
sat balance
317425
outputs
b46dcad88a36084430dc2347202a45b1b2fd221b55f9ea26d4b79a62e4e20fb5:22